Abstract
The aim of this research is to find a method to quickly define soil porosity in the
field based on measurement of soil compaction by using Daiki push cone-5553. The
research results showed that soil moisture has almost no relationship to soil compaction
and soil porosity because R2
equal 0.0182 and 0.0384 in order and Sig. >0.05, therefore
soil moisture should be ignored when building a look-up table of soil porosity based on
measurement of soil compaction. In contrast, soil compaction has a relatively strong
relationship to soil porosity because R2
= 0.6994 and Sig. = 0.00 < 0.05, hence this model
can be used to define soil porosity in the field. Nevertheless, this research is limited at
student thesis so this could happen errors. To summarize, it is necessary to do further
studies with larger scope of research to conduct data with variety of information, then
update a new look-up table of soil porosity to serve human researches.
